Surrey Board of Trade Applauds Long-Term Public Transit Investment for TransLink

The Surrey Board of Trade applauds the Federal Government’s commitment to public transit through the Canada Public Transit Fund (CPTF), which will provide TransLink with up to $663.7 million over ten years, from 2026 to 2036. This funding aims to support the development of sustainable, inclusive, and accessible transit systems across Metro Vancouver.

“The allocation of these funds is a vital step toward ensuring long-term, predictable investments in public transit infrastructure. This is what the Surrey Board of Trade has been advocating for,” said Jasroop Gosal, Interim Spokesperson for the Surrey Board of Trade. “This funding will not only support Metro Vancouver’s growing population but also enhance economic growth, workforce mobility, and environmental sustainability.”

Starting in 2026-27, the CPTF will deliver an average of $3 billion annually across Canada to address local needs by enhancing transit and active transportation options. For TransLink, the $663.7 million in funding will be contingent upon submitting a capital plan and signing a funding agreement with the Federal Government. This ensures accountability while aligning investments with community and business priorities.

“Reliable transit infrastructure is fundamental for economic growth,” added Gosal. “As one of the fastest-growing municipalities in Metro Vancouver, Surrey requires robust transit solutions and investments to meet the increasing demands of businesses and residents alike.”
